Winter: cool binds, ice adhesives, metal shrinks

On the coldest mornings, phones ring early. The pattern recognizes: the opener hums yet the door will not budge, or it increases a foot and turns around. Right here's what the weather is doing behind the scenes.

Steel contracts in the cold. Tracks obtain simply a bit tighter against the rollers, and clearances close. At the same time, manufacturing facility oil on the rollers and hinges thickens. If you have nylon rollers, you lead the game, but even they reduce in a January snap. The opener detects extra resistance and, relying on setups, either powers via or stops to protect the system.

Bottom seals adhere the piece. That rubber frost-weld is strong enough to delay an opener and strip a gear. If you see the lower astragal stuck, stand up to the urge to hit the button consistently. Utilize a hair clothes dryer or put cozy, not boiling, water along the seal to free it. Then towel off the threshold so it does not refreeze immediately.

Springs really feel stiffer. Torsion springs supply torque by twisting steel wire. Cold decreases flexibility, which implies more force is required to lift the exact same weight. If your springtimes were minimal in October, they feel weak in February. You could discover the opener straining, or the door wandering down when left halfway open.

Photo eyes and tracks collect salt sludge. Roadway spray becomes a sandy paste that adventures up on the rollers and constructs in the tracks. Combined with chilly contraction, that grit suffices to halt a panel at mid-travel.

What aids: a real winter months song tailored to Joliet. Wipe and re-lubricate rollers, joints, and bearing plates with a cold-rated silicone or lithium item. Clean the upright tracks with a rag; don't load them with oil. Check downforce and travel limits on the opener. Heat up fragile weatherstripping with a quick clean of silicone spray to keep it adaptable. And test the balance. An effectively counterbalanced door should raise by hand with modest initiative and stay at concerning waistline elevation without creeping.

Spring: thaw, grit, and misalignment

Spring is when winter season's deposit dawns. Meltwater moves into places you forgot existed, after that dries out and leaves behind penalties that imitate shutoff splashing substance. Tracks might change slightly in anchors if lag screws antagonized soft framing with temperature level cycles.

Doors that ran penalty in March start to chatter in April. You begin seeing the door open up a foot, time out, after that proceed. That pause is the opener analysis fluctuating resistance as the rollers hit dirty track areas or a joint that took on a small bend when the door stuck mid-winter.

Another springtime story is the leaning garage. Frost heave in slab sides can raise simply enough to throw a bottom panel out of parallel with the floor. Base seals that were tight in November might reveal light spaces by April. Small modifications to the limit settings can mask the symptom, yet if the underlying floor moved, you intend to resolve that with shimming, a limit ramp, or a scribed seal so the opener isn't required to overtravel.

This is likewise when we identify micro-rust on cable televisions and bottom fixtures. Saltwater leaves matched strands, https://rentry.co/hy9tofsf and when matching begins, cable failing risk climbs fast. Changing lift cords is simple and much less costly than repairing civilian casualties after a breeze. Summer: heat, moisture, and power surprises

By July, the fight modifications. Warmth loosens up some points and chefs others. Humidity swells wood and feeds deterioration. You additionally see more terrible electrical storms in the forecast, which suggests brownouts.

Steel increases in heat. Tracks expand a hair, which may sound like great news, however development can transform placement. If the vertical track brackets weren't tightened appropriately, they can drift. You'll hear a rattle at the middle of traveling or see the door rub on the quit molding.

image

Wood or composite overlays handle moisture. That extra mass places more tons on springtimes sized for a drier panel. If you upgraded panels without resizing springs, summertime exposes the inequality. The opener whines with a warm electric motor case or a distinctive burning odor if it has a hard time. Openers suffer in warmth. Many residential systems are ranked to run in garages as much as approximately 120 degrees at the ceiling. In an uninsulated garage with a dark roofing, you come close to that array. Circuit card don't like it. Think about a small gable air vent or a light reflective door to go down peak heat a little bit. A protected door is also normally stiffer, which keeps panels truer over time.

Storms bring lightning and flickers. Power rises can fry reasoning boards. A plug-in rise protector ranked for garage-door openers is a low-cost insurance coverage. I've changed too many boards after a July squall that tripped half the road. For business centers, tie openers and security edges into an effectively based circuit and utilize industrial-grade surge reductions. After any type of interruption, reconsider travel limitations, considering that some devices shed track slightly and require a quick reset.

Finally, summer dirt coats image eyes. Crawlers adore those warm corners. A web throughout the lens will quit the door randomly times. Wipe lenses with a soft cloth and keep the eyes lined up at 6 inches off the floor. That elevation typical issues for safety.

Fall: the configuration season

If you only do one scheduled Garage Door Solution a year, publication it in late loss. You capture small concerns before the cold magnifies them, and you establish your system's lubrication and balance for the hardest season.

A comprehensive loss adjustment consists of tightening up all easily accessible fasteners, examining spring torque against door weight, exchanging any type of cracked nylon rollers, and setting opener downforce with a real-world examination. I such as to run the door by hand for 3 complete cycles after service. Your hand will feel what the motor will deal with later on, and a smooth hand-cycle in October usually forecasts a peaceful February.

Weatherstripping is entitled to focus now. Base seals flatten, side vinyl expands brittle, and leading seals reduce. Replacing a bottom astragal is a 20 to 40 minute job for many household doors and repays with a warmer garage and fewer freeze-ups. Side seals minimize drafts that otherwise force the opener to antagonize a tight initial foot of travel.

Material matters: steel, wood, aluminum, and fiberglass

Every door product has a climate personality.

Steel is the Joliet standard for good reason. It's strong per buck, is available in shielded alternatives, and holds up. But steel rusts. The lower panel side and the equipment around it take the worst of the splash. If you see gurgling paint near the bottom edge, sand, prime, and secure it prior to winter months. On the hardware side, zinc layering just goes so far. Plan on routine replacement of lower brackets and hinges in salted garages.

Wood looks lovely, specifically on older homes, but it is one of the most conscious dampness swings. In summertime, expect panel swell; in winter season, reduce and potential voids. Complete maintenance is nonnegotiable. A timber door that lives outside in Joliet requires a premium exterior finish refreshed every number of years. If you love the appearance yet not the upkeep, a steel door with a woodgrain overlay could be a wise middle road.

Aluminum is light and stands up to corrosion, which makes it attractive along hectic roads with hefty salt usage. It damages more easily. Thermal conductivity is high, so pick a shielded version. Development with warmth is likewise extra noticable. Track and joint positioning needs to be accurate to prevent racking on those hot days.

Fiberglass and compounds manage moisture well and can mimic timber well. They match nicely with polyurethane insulation for a stiff, peaceful panel. UV can chalk less expensive coatings in time, so look for quality gel coats and bear in mind west-facing exposures.

An insulated door is worth a special note. Insulation adjustments 3 points. It includes weight, boosts panel rigidity, and moderates inside temperature swings. The result is normally a quieter door with much less flex in wind and a garage that remains 10 to 20 levels warmer in winter season and cooler in summer season. In our area, that comfort enhancement is real. It also reduces the number of freeze-related stalls. Openers and electronic devices: sensitivity, limits, and Joliet quirks

Modern openers are much safer and smarter than older chain-drives, but they are additionally extra sensitive to friction modifications brought on by weather. That is by design. If the door binds, the opener needs to quit. The method is to establish them appropriately for our climate.

Downforce and take a trip restrictions are not one-and-done. If your door runs flawlessly on a light September afternoon, the same settings may be as well light on a February morning or also strong for a sticky July afternoon. An excellent technician songs restrictions by testing in both instructions from a dead-cold start. For belt-drives, examine the belt stress when cold and hot; temperature modifications can loosen up belts and produce a put that appears like a motor problem.

Battery back-ups became a lot more typical after regional interruptions. In winter, chilly shortens battery life. Test back-ups before the initial storm. If your opener has a MyQ or comparable smart part, know that garage Wi-Fi can struggle in insulated, foil-faced frameworks. A $30 repeater near the house-to-garage door addresses half-cracked connectivity that commonly obtains misdiagnosed as an opener fault.

Surge protection in Joliet is not optional. Summertime lightning, winter season grid stress, and construction-related spots on growth hallways all take a toll. Plug-in surge devices are a begin. For industrial sites, panel-level defense is more appropriate.

The industrial angle: anchors, cycles, and downtime math

A warehouse door that fails in July when you've got perishables on the dock sets you back greater than a repair service expense. It costs in labor, perishing danger, and consumer confidence. Filling dock door upkeep solutions in Joliet focus on the hinge points where weather intensifies wear: lower bar seals, overview tracks, safety eyes near the floor that being in pools, and control boxes that see regular slaps from gloved hands.

Cycle counts are the solitary most important number in commercial planning. A spring ranked for 10,000 cycles on a door that runs 80 times a day is salute in 4 months. High-cycle springs and arranged substitutes move you out of emergency situation setting. Add a quarterly cleaning of overviews and verification that door brakes and chain lifts function. Train personnel to spot very early cautions: new screeches, drifting doors, or panels that think twice at a particular height. Those are telltales of track damages or a curved joint that weather will certainly exploit.

Practical care you can do in between services

You do not require to end up being a technology to keep your system happy. A couple of behaviors, linked to the seasons, go a lengthy way.

    After snow or a freezing rainfall, clear slush from the limit and kick out ice ridges along the door line prior to evening temperature levels drop. Once a month, wipe photo-eye lenses and brush the tracks with a dry rag. Stand up to the urge to oil the tracks. Lubricate just the hinges, springtimes (gently), and rollers with a garage-door ranked product.

Listen to your door. It should keep up a constant hum and light mechanical chatter. New thumps, screeches, or disproportion are extra interesting than the majority of diagnostic lights. If the door begins to close and reverses without any obstruction, look to photo eyes first, after that to boosted rubbing from weather changes. Real Joliet snapshots

Two stories stick with me. A Plainfield homeowner called in February: opener grinding, door glued to the flooring. He had actually pushed the remote five times, wishing it would "capture." The nylon drive gear on his opener surrendered. We released the seal with a warmth weapon, changed the equipment package, cleaned the tracks, and reset downforce. Before leaving, we switched his squashed bottom seal and revealed him the warm-water method. The equipment package price more than a new seal, and timing the force in November would likely have actually conserved both.

At a circulation dock off Path 6, three nearby roll-up doors were sticking at chest elevation every moist mid-day. Maintenance had actually oiled the overviews greatly, thinking it would certainly aid. Actually, the grease combined with dust to develop a brake. We degreased the guides, replaced two kinked slats, included light dry-film lubricant, and realigned security edges that had actually sneaked from duplicated influences. We additionally moved their quarterly solution one month previously right into September. The issue didn't return the next summer.
